  General Notes:

In a 1915 document in the British Army Records James McIver was recorded as being a member of the Army Veterinary Corps. His place of residence was noted as 30 Marshall Street Glasgow and his date of marriage to Margaret Russell as 8 July 1902.

James died before Margaret. He was recorded in her death certificate as a 'general dealer' and he was a well known figure in Glasgow. 2 3


James married Margaret RUSSELL, daughter of Unknown and Margaret Selanders RUSSELL, on 8 Jul 1902 in 21 Abbotsford Place, Glasgow, Scotland.1 2 (Margaret RUSSELL was born 27 November 1880 at 0.30 am in Church Lane, Loudoun, Ayrshire, Scotland 5 and died 31 May 1958 at 3.05 am in 138 Blairbeth Road, Burnside, Lanarkshire, Scotland 6.). The cause of her death was anaemia and myocarditis.


  Marriage Notes:

The marriage was performed after banns according to the forms of the Church of Scotland. Robert K. Monteath, minister of Hutchesontown parish, married the couple. The witnesses were John MacLean, who made his X mark, and Susan Begley.

James McIver was a fruit dealer by occupation. He was unmarried and aged 21 years. His address was noted as 60 Rose Street, South Glasgow. Both of his parents were deceased.

Margaret Russell was a fish hawker. She too was unmarried and was aged 21 years. Her address was 80 Rose Street, South Glasgow. Her mother was recorded as "Margaret Selanders. Her father was recorded as a labourer, and deceased. (see note below)

The marriage was registered on 9 July 1902 at Glasgow, the registrar being John Brown.

Note: Margaret Russell's parents names were recorded as Thomas Russell and Margaret Selanders in this marriage certificate. Other sources demonstrate conclusively that this was not an accurate statement. 1
